Output 11831fa37289ed437c788ea486d096266b95baba9524c61e7fe277eeb923a914:17

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 1455fcb8ccf67f38adc11e89f90d08eba82e0de9
address
tb1qz32lewxv7eln3twpr6yljrggaw5zur0f5zvr9n
transaction
11831fa37289ed437c788ea486d096266b95baba9524c61e7fe277eeb923a914
confirmations
12655
spent
true